This stunning terraced period property on Milton Park offers a captivating blend of classic charm and contemporary design.
Light-Filled Living
The front of the house boasts a large, open-plan kitchen reception area, perfect for modern living. Bespoke built-in shelving offers a stylish solution for displaying your treasured items, while the expansive bay window floods the space with natural light. Underfoot, beautiful herringbone wood flooring adds a touch of warmth and character.
Seating for All Seasons
Towards the rear of the property, a dedicated dining area with a wood burner creates a cozy and inviting atmosphere. Perfect for hosting dinner parties or enjoying family meals, this space seamlessly transitions into a stylish conservatory bathed in sunlight. French doors provide effortless access to a private garden, ideal for al fresco dining in warmer months.
A Home decorated with Style
This unique property offers the best of both worlds, combining the elegance of a period terrace with the functionality and style of modern design. Whether you're entertaining guests or simply relaxing at home, this versatile space caters to your every need. The wardrobes in the master are lined with cedar (to deter moths from your cashmere).
The garden design is inspired by Vita Sackville-West White Garden at Sissinghurst. It has a curated collection of white flowering plants, including roses, cosmos, camelia Jasmine, agapanthus, magnolia and lilac trees, lupins, and hydrangeas.
Milton Park, located in Highgate (N6), is a sought-after conservation area known for its tranquil streets lined with elegant Victorian and Georgian townhouses. While steeped in history, it offers a vibrant community feel. Transport Connections: Residents enjoy excellent transport links, with Highgate Underground Station (Northern Line) just a short walk away, providing easy access to central London. Several bus routes also run through the area, offering further connection options.
Shops and Cafes:For your everyday needs, there are a variety of shops lining Highgate High Street, just a short distance from Milton Park. Here you'll find a selection of independent stores, including delicatessens, butchers, and greengrocers, alongside popular cafes and restaurants serving everything from international cuisine to traditional pub fare.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
